Platform Engineers at Whatnot own the foundations of our main backends, real-time services, and storage systems. The team ensures these core platforms evolve to support rapid product growth while remaining reliable and scalable. This role is focused on our Python-based main backend and our storage platforms. You will help scale and optimize the runtime, refactor and modularize our codebases, improve storage systems, and build shared platform services and components that underpin the product experience. You will work on problems like: Evolving our Python runtime and stack by improving performance, concurrency, memory use, and dependency management. Building and scaling core platform services that provide the foundation for reliability, scalability, and developer velocity across engineering. Optimizing storage systems for consistency, scale, and performance. Embedding observability and reliability patterns into the platform by default. Refactoring and modularizing large-scale codebases to maintain developer velocity and ensure our primary codebases remain a productive environment at scale. Partnering with product and infra teams to deliver platform APIs and abstractions that strike the right balance between velocity and long-term stability. Laying the groundwork for future platform needs, from global expansion to enabling new product capabilities. This is a highly visible role: the platform team provides the technical foundation that allows Whatnot to scale rapidly while remaining reliable.
Stand Out From the Crowd
Upload your resume and get instant feedback on how well it matches this job.
Job Type
Full-time
Career Level
Senior
Number of Employees
501-1,000 employees